Moreno Valley, California has 29 ranked elementary schools with an average Scope Score of 27.5/100 — 11.3 points below the state average of 38.8. The highest-scoring school is North Ridge Elementary at 48/100, where 25.0% of students exceed the state standard on the 2025 CAASPP assessment. Moreno Valley schools average 11.1% exceeded standard (state: 21.3%) — this exceeded-vs-met distinction reveals whether schools push students beyond proficiency or pace toward it. Of 29 schools, 2 Growth Engines stand out for their performance profiles. Chronic absenteeism averages 26.7% (above the state average of 17.9%). Data source: California Department of Education CAASPP 2025, analyzed by SchoolScope.

School archetypes in Moreno Valley
Hidden gems: 12 schools in Moreno Valley are classified as On the Rise (10) or Growth Engine (2) \u2014 showing positive growth trajectories that raw proficiency scores alone don't capture. These are schools where students leave with more than they arrived with.

Scores are SchoolScope's analysis of public data, not official CDE ratings. They represent one way of interpreting test results and should not be the sole basis for school decisions.
Private Schools in Moreno Valley
Private schools don't participate in California's standardized testing (CAASPP) and cannot be scored or ranked. Showing enrollment, student-teacher ratio, and affiliation where available.
Numbers tell you whether students are clearing the bar. A school visit tells you whether they're happy doing it. These metrics are intentionally missing from the Scope Score: class sizes and student-teacher interaction quality; arts, music, athletics, and enrichment programs; teacher experience and turnover; campus safety and social-emotional support; parent and community engagement; quality of special education and gifted programs; how school zones and enrollment boundaries affect access.
